  • Patent number: 9272993
    Abstract: The present invention provides pharmaceutical compositions comprising substituted 1,4 naphthoquinones that are effective in preventing oligomerization of beta amyloid and subsequent pathologies associated with amyloid fibrils. These compositions are useful for the treatment of disease involving amyloidogenesis including ne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er's Disease or senile dementia. Particularly effective compositions comprise 1,4 naphthoquinones substituted with an amino acid residue selected from a heterocyclic or aromatic amino acid.
